Quick view Add to Cart The item has been added Ann Demeulemeester Mini Shorts 23856976 MSRP: Was: Now: ¥10,445
Quick view Add to Cart The item has been added Ann Demeulemeester Mini Shorts 23101793 MSRP: Was: Now: ¥8,035
Quick view Add to Cart The item has been added Ann Demeulemeester Mini Shorts 28820643 MSRP: Was: Now: ¥23,300
Quick view Add to Cart The item has been added Ann Demeulemeester Mini Shorts (ANN48564) MSRP: Was: Now: ¥15,266
Quick view Add to Cart The item has been added Ann Demeulemeester Mini Shorts 29217151 MSRP: Was: Now: ¥24,907